Transaction 8ab8b3f9dba1ec8954969a9df022d60a64316f19668ed7013026aa038e8deabd
1 Input
1 Output
-
8ab8b3f9dba1ec8954969a9df022d60a64316f19668ed7013026aa038e8deabd:0
- value
- 39511295
- script pubkey
- OP_0 OP_PUSHBYTES_20 f029184065f57f6f5bde87578c8275a3f76ade3e
- address
- bc1q7q53ssr974lk7k77satceqn450mk4h379dulql